Vertical Greening Bag-type refers to a method of vertical gardening that uses bags filled with soil and plants to create green spaces on walls or other vertical surfaces. This technique is commonly used in urban environments to add greenery where traditional gardening is not possible. The bags are often designed with drainage holes to prevent waterlogging and are hung on walls or mounted on structures for easy installation and maintenance.

Green roofing case studies refer to detailed examples of buildings or structures that have implemented green roofs. These roofs are covered with vegetation, which can provide numerous environmental, economic, and social benefits. Case studies typically analyze the design, installation, performance, and sustainability of these green roofs, offering insights into best practices and challenges in green roofing technology.
